#67610e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#67610e is composed of 40.4% red, 38%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 5.8% magenta, 86.4% yellow and 59.6% black. It has a hue angle of 56 degrees, a saturation of 76.1% and a lightness of 22.9%. #67610e color hex could be obtained by blending #cec21c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

#67610e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#67610e has RGB values of R:103, G:97, B:14 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.06, Y:0.86, K:0.6. Its decimal value is 6775054.

Shades and Tints of #67610e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#111002 is the darkest color, while #fffff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#67610e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3f3e37 is the less saturated color, while #756d00 is the most saturated one.
